为了账号安全,请及时绑定邮箱和手机立即绑定

如何高效地在3小时之内处理15000个订单

如何高效地在3小时之内处理15000个订单

car 2017-08-31 18:17:54
面试的题目,从代码,数据库方面说说
查看完整描述

1 回答

?
a_flying_fish

TA贡献9条经验 获得超4个赞

代码上,能用编译型,不选择解释型,尽量用C语言甚至汇编,可以考虑多线程编程,然后数据库的操作极度优化。这是从代码的选取角度,从设计角度,尽量减少使用者的操作,更多的工作由电脑完成,最后不同的操作。都能够一键操作

查看完整回答
反对 回复 2017-09-01
  • car
    car
    高深,听不太懂。
  • a_flying_fish
    a_flying_fish
    程序粗糙的可以分为设计和编写,如果算上使用者的操作时间,这个才算是真正意义上的处理速度。无论如何电脑还是比人快,所以尽量设计一键操作。至于代码怎么提高运行速度,一般就是代码本身的运行速度(C语言运行速度接近python的二十倍),第二个就是算法的优化
  • a_flying_fish
    a_flying_fish
    这只是我个人的理解,没有什么可供参考的资料,你可以听听见解
  • 1 回答
  • 0 关注
  • 1503 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信